Nettet21. nov. 2024 · It releases bile in to the small intestine in an orderly manner in response to food intake. When the gallbladder is removed, this function is lost. The bile from the liver enters the small intestine directly. There is no control mechanism to regulate this flow of bile, so it will flow continuously after a gallbladder removal surgery.
